  3. Film review: Zombie-themed 'Warm Bodies' storyline just lukewarm

    I have to admit that it was a great decision to release a movie called "Warm Bodies" in February. The title makes for a terrific invitation to get out of the cold and into a theater. If the film were called "Warm Bodies Wrapped up in Snuggly Blankets and Drinking Rich Hot Cocoa," it would really be unstoppable. Maybe if there's a sequel.
